## Step 4: Cold Start Mitigation

Handlers in the Ferngate stack are pre-warmed by the scheduler pinging each function every 10 minutes. Do not disable this; cold starts add ~2s and break the latency SLO. Warmers run with read-only scope. Provisioned concurrency is set per environment in warm.json — review it before approving. After confirming warm.json matches the approved baseline, seal the deploy manifest so the gate can verify it; sign with the key below.

release key, kawif-hawep: bky13_X7TGuRG4Zu4ZJ

[ ] Verify Gatewright rate limiter: per-tenant buckets enforced at 200 rps, burst 50, 429s carry Retry-After. Confirm the Okapi staging tier sheds load before the upstream pool saturates. Reviewer should diff limiter config against the frozen release manifest and sign off only after matching it to the token stamped under this line.

session token of tajef-bageg = htk21_5d90d574934f3ccae6437

# Basement Archive Room — Night Access

The archive room under Pellworth House holds old contracts and the tape backups. Night shift: take stairwell C, not the lift (it's switched off after midnight). Lights are on a timer by the door — slap the button as you go in. Sign the logbook, even at 3am, yes really. The keypad by the door takes the code below.

staff pass of fahap-tajeg = bdg-FT-6

## Deployment: Digest Scheduling

The Mailwren digest worker batches subscriber emails into hourly, daily, and weekly sends. Scheduling is driven entirely by the cron expressions defined at deploy time, so a bad value will silently skip a whole send window — verify against the staging clock before promoting. Note that the worker reads its schedule once at startup; any change requires a rolling restart of the digest pods. The full set of configuration values the worker expects at boot is listed below.

deployment values, kahof-yadug:
[gorys]
team = silael
access_code = ac_00d620
owner = istox.oliys
host = gorys.torvastack.example
port = 9000
peer = holmir.merlaqsoft.example
salt = 9fdae78a
pin = 2358